What companies run services between Nice, France and Biarritz, France?

easyJet and Transavia France fly from Nice Côte D'Azur International Airport (NCE) to Biarritz Pays Basque Airport (BIQ) once daily. Alternatively, you can take a train from Nice Ville to Biarritz via Marseille St Charles, Toulouse Matabiau, and Biarritz in around 12h 21m.
